Imagine someone arriving on a software company's website with a precise problem: they need to connect billing with CRM or build a portal for VoIP customers. If the first thing they see is a broad promise about ‘digital transformation’, they still have to guess whether the company understands the work. A search engine faces a similar problem. A polished but vague page offers few clues about which queries genuinely match the service.
SEO architecture therefore does not begin by inserting keywords. It begins by organising knowledge: which problems we solve, for whom, through which services, what evidence we can show and which questions we can answer. Titles, metadata, schema and technical optimisation come after that foundation.
Start with buyer questions rather than the menu
A useful structure reflects how a decision is made. A potential customer wants to learn quickly whether you understand the problem, have worked with a similar process, what a solution may include and what the next step is. A technology list does not answer those questions. React, Go and MySQL can support credibility, but they are not the reason a company buys.
List the main groups of needs and assign pages to them. For an operational software company, these might include VoIP and SMS platforms, CRM/ERP workflows, SaaS and client portals, billing and API integrations. Websites, e-commerce, SEO and AI are clearer when presented in the context of the process they support. This hierarchy helps both people and search engines understand the offer.
Give one important intent one strong page
Putting every service on the home page usually produces short descriptions competing for attention. A dedicated page can explain the context, common scenarios, scope, integrations, risks and a sensible way to begin. This is not an argument for producing many near-identical pages for small keyword variations.
Every page needs a distinct role. If two pages answer the same question and lead to the same offer, combine them. If a service serves a different audience, workflow and evidence set, a separate page makes sense. A useful test is whether you can write a unique title and complete this sentence: ‘after reading this page, the customer will understand…’.
Build a path from overview to detail
The home page introduces the company and its main areas. A service page expands one problem. A case study shows how a related challenge was addressed, while an article helps the reader understand a particular decision. These elements should connect rather than form separate islands.
Someone reading a VoIP security checklist should be able to continue to the telecom service and a relevant case study. A visitor reviewing a CRM project may need an article about data integration. Internal links should follow the reader's next logical question instead of mechanically repeating a phrase. A coherent path keeps attention because every next page adds new information.
Write case studies as evidence, not advertising
A case study becomes credible when it explains context, constraints, responsibility and outcome. ‘We built a modern platform’ says very little about experience. A description of the workflow is more useful: which systems needed to connect, where the risks were, what was automated and how the result supports everyday operations.
Do not publish data the customer has not approved, and never fill gaps with assumptions. When numeric outcomes cannot be shared, describe the architecture, user types, information flow and safeguards. Every case study should link to its relevant service, and each service should surface appropriate projects. This creates a natural connection between the commercial description and proof of capability.
Create articles that help someone do the work
A short post containing three broad tips may be correct but is rarely memorable. A useful article begins with a situation the reader recognises, explains the consequences of a decision, provides an order of work and warns about common mistakes. After closing the page, the reader should be able to prepare better meeting questions, review an internal process or make a smaller decision.
Checklists, option comparisons, rollout plans, sample workflows and answers to real sales questions all work well. There is no need to inflate the word count. Every section should add a concrete step or perspective. Human language, shorter sentences and recognisable context are more valuable than keyword density.
Then refine the technical layer
Once the architecture is clear, prepare unique titles and descriptions, one primary heading, a logical H2–H3 hierarchy, canonical URLs and language alternatives. The sitemap should contain only pages intended for indexing. Structured data can describe the organisation, service, article and navigation, but it must match content visible to users.
Technical SEO also includes speed, layout stability, mobile behaviour and accessibility. An oversized hero image, incorrect responsive image sizes or a script blocking interaction can weaken excellent content. Measure these issues on the running website. A tool score is not the final goal; the goal is a page that answers the question quickly and does not obstruct the next action.
Measure traffic quality and keep content current
More visits do not always create a better outcome. A service company needs the right readers to reach the right pages, continue to relevant work, make contact and ask questions aligned with the offer. Analyse search queries and user paths, but review their quality with the sales team as well.
Every few months, check whether the service still reflects the current scope, links point to the strongest material and articles do not rely on outdated assumptions. Expand pages with clear intent and business value. Merge or remove content that duplicates another topic. Good architecture is not a tree drawn once; it evolves with the offer and with customer questions.
